They faced many threats along their journey back into the wild, and unfortunately, three of them died. In December, Palina\u2019s GPS transmitter went silent, and scientists assumed she was also dead. Months passed by until her signal reappeared on the radars. She is alive and well, and not far away from her last registered position.&nbsp; &n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img fetchpriority=\"high\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"768\" src=\"http:\/\/4vultures.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/09\/Griffon-Vulture_release-Croatia-Cres2023_LIFE-SUPport_BIOM_10-1024x768.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-36092\" srcset=\"https:\/\/4vultures.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/09\/Griffon-Vulture_release-Croatia-Cres2023_LIFE-SUPport_BIOM_10-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/4vultures.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/09\/Griffon-Vulture_release-Croatia-Cres2023_LIFE-SUPport_BIOM_10-300x225.jpg 300w, https:\/\/4vultures.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/09\/Griffon-Vulture_release-Croatia-Cres2023_LIFE-SUPport_BIOM_10-768x576.jpg 768w, https:\/\/4vultures.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/09\/Griffon-Vulture_release-Croatia-Cres2023_LIFE-SUPport_BIOM_10-1536x1152.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/4vultures.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/09\/Griffon-Vulture_release-Croatia-Cres2023_LIFE-SUPport_BIOM_10-2048x1536.jpg 2048w, https:\/\/4vultures.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/09\/Griffon-Vulture_release-Croatia-Cres2023_LIFE-SUPport_BIOM_10-16x12.jpg 16w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Griffon Vulture release on Cres Island, Croatia &#8211; LIFE SUPPort \u00a9 BIOM<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>A rough beginning <\/strong>&nbsp;<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Palina\u2019s story begins on the cliffs of the Kvarner Islands. Croatian <a href=\"https:\/\/4vultures.org\/es\/vultures\/griffon-vulture\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Griffon Vultures<\/a> are among the few colonies that nest right above the sea, on incredibly steep cliffs. This peculiar and picturesque nesting area poses a threat to vulture fledglings. It is not unusual for them to fall into the sea attempting their first flight, or to get stuck on the rocks underneath the cliff, too tired to fly back to the nest. Palina was one of these unlucky fledglings. &n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Fortunately, her fate changed since she was rescued and rehabilitated, together with three other young vultures, by the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.facebook.com\/BeliVisitorCentre\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Beli Vulture Recovery<\/a> Centre on the island of Cres. They were found exhausted under the nesting coastal cliffs of Cres and Plavnik or rescued from drowning directly from the sea. Nursed back to health, in September 2023 they were declared fit to go back to their natural habitat. Each of the vultures took the name of one of the European volunteers who looked after them during their recovery: Palina, Colina, Lima, and Anton. The data registered thanks to the GPS transmitters helped scientists follow their journey and identify the threats that determined their fate.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Lima crossed the Adriatic Sea and made it to Italy. Griffon Vultures normally do not fly over the sea. They need warm air currents generated on land (thermals) to cover long distances. She crossed Italy, reaching the Calabria region where she unfortunately collided with power lines. <a href=\"https:\/\/4vultures.org\/es\/blog\/protecting-griffon-vultures-from-electrocution-in-croatia\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Electrocution and collisions with power lines<\/a> are among the biggest threats to this species. At the beginning of November, less than two months after her release, Lima\u2019s transmitter signalled her death.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Anton flew southeast towards Bulgaria, but his fate was similar to Lima\u2019s. His transmitter showed no movements, and the Bulgarian team found him dead. He also probably died colliding with power lines. His body, like Lima\u2019s, has been sent for an autopsy. &n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Coline flew south, reaching Greece in just two weeks. Sadly, her GPS transmitter showed unusual movements compatible with sea currents. Scientists believe she drowned in the Ionian Sea.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Never say never <\/strong>&nbsp;<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Palina also moved southeast. She flew over the Balkan Peninsula for about three months and crossed the Bosphorus. In December, the team lost the signal from her transmitter. Considering the fate of her companions, she was proclaimed dead. &n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Palina\u2019s story took an unexpected turn with the new year. Surprisingly, sixty days after we thought she was lost forever, her transmitter sent a signal from Turkey, not far from her last known position. She is alive and well, the last survivor of her group.
